About This Facility

Bainbridge Treatment Center, situated in Bainbridge, GA, provides a comprehensive array of outpatient treatment options for adults and young adults struggling with substance use. The center focuses on outpatient therapies involving methadone/buprenorphine or naltrexone, alongside regular outpatient services. They employ various evidence-based techniques such as anger management, cognitive behavioral therapy, and contingency management/motivational incentives. Moreover, the facility offers tailored programs specifically designed for adult women, individuals who have faced intimate partner or domestic violence, and clients dealing with both mental health and substance use disorders. Committed to personalized care, Bainbridge Treatment Center strives to deliver quality rehabilitation services to both male and female clients on their recovery journey.
